Description
Chef de Partie
Full Time, Permanent
GBP30,508 GBP34,732 per annum
This is an exciting opportunity for a creative and talented chef to further develop their culinary skills and engage in a wide range of innovative cooking styles within our modern & fully equipped kitchen.
The Chef de Partie will be working as part of a team to ensure the provision of high-quality meals to fellows, students, staff, guests, and commercial customers. A commitment to produce high quality cuisine in a busy kitchen environment is essential along with a positive professional attitude.
Salary range: GBP28,778-GBP33,002 p.a. plus GBP1,730 p.a. Oxford Weighting Allowance.
Hours of work: 40 hours per week, working 5 out of 7 days, predominately straight shifts and alternate weekends off.
Essential skills, experience and qualifications:
Level 2 Food Safety Certificate or equivalent Level 3 Professional Cookery or equivalent qualification/experience Experience in a busy kitchen including large-scale catering General experience in all sections of a kitchen Ability to produce a wide variety of dishes, including vegetarian, vegan and other restricted diet meal types Good knowledge of handling food allergies Ability to keep all necessary records in accordance with the food hygiene regulations Familiarity with health and safety practices including COSHH and HACCP Excellent benefits including:
30 days holiday including Christmas shutdown, plus bank holidays Generous contributory pension scheme Uniform provided and laundered Training & development opportunities Strong focus on positive work-life balance Travel pass/cycle to work scheme Meals on duty New College is an Equal Opportunities Employer.
